Job description

Provide comprehensive IT support to all administrative and educational staff, ensuring effective use of systems and applications (intranet and internet). Oversee the installation, configuration, maintenance, and monitoring of the school's computer hardware, operating systems, and related technologies.

Key accountabilities:

  • Install, configure, and maintain servers, PCs, peripherals, IT equipment, packaged software, antivirus programs, utilities, tools, and patches.
  • Administer and upgrade the school's computer network infrastructure to ensure optimal performance and security.
  • Verify functionality of all new equipment prior to deployment.
  • Troubleshoot issues related to hardware, software, network infrastructure, applications, viruses, and security threats.
  • Set up IT equipment in offices, classrooms, and labs, including user accounts and profiles.
  • Respond promptly to emergency classroom calls involving equipment, software, or network problems, and provide technical support for educational software projects.
  • Prioritize reported issues based on severity and coordinate with relevant parties for resolution.
  • Engage with users to assess IT needs, recommend best practices, and implement effective solutions to support teaching and administrative goals.
  • Manage and ensure compliance with procedures related to data backups, software updates, data transfers, imports/exports, and system restoration as needed.
  • Maintain records of site software licenses and alert relevant IT teams regarding required upgrades or renewals.
  • Keep an up-to-date inventory of all hardware, software, and associated credentials.
  • Collaborate with IT teams on all school IT matters, including policy implementation, systems integration, infrastructure development, procurement, upgrades, warranties, replacements, new technology initiatives, and budgeting.
  • Ensure full compliance with policies, procedures, and codes of conduct at all times.
  • Perform additional duties as assigned by line managers or supervisors.

Skills

Qualifications & experience:

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or a related field.
  • Minimum of five (5) years of hands-on experience in managing and maintaining ICT infrastructure, preferably within a school environment.
  • Strong communication skills, keen attention to detail, and effective technical problem-solving abilities.
  • Capable of multitasking and working efficiently under pressure during peak periods.

IT knowledge:

  • Proficient in managing a wide range of hardware and infrastructure, including:
  • Servers, data and voice cabling, network switches, wireless access points and controllers, routers, firewalls, internet lines, and IP telephony.
  • End-user devices such as PCs, laptops, tablets, printers, and peripherals.
  • Multimedia equipment including projectors, interactive smart boards, robotics kits, video conferencing systems, digital signage, and AV equipment.
  • Skilled in Microsoft server operating systems and enterprise-level IT applications:
  • Windows Server 2019/2022 (Advanced/Enterprise editions), Microsoft Defender, System Center Endpoint Protection for servers.
  • Experience with file servers, databases, and Microsoft Office 365 (including Exchange and other cloud-based services).
